On the morning of April 16, 2025, at Hall 300A – District 4 Campus, the NTT Institute of International Education – Nguyen Tat Thanh University (NIIE) successfully hosted the Cultural Exchange and Traditional New Year Celebration for Bunpimay (Laos) and Chol Chnam Thmay (Cambodia). The event created a vibrant multicultural space, offering international students at NIIE – NTTU a warm and meaningful opportunity to celebrate the New Year far from home.

Cuisine – Performances – Games: A Vivid Cultural Tapestry
One of the highlights of the event was the Lao–Cambodian–Vietnamese fusion cooking competition. Traditional dishes like Laap, Tam Mak Hoong, Nhoam Svay Kchai, Bánh Khọt, Bánh Mì Chảo, and Chân Gà Sả Tắc brought excitement and energy to the atmosphere. Through the talented hands of students, the essence of homeland and cultural identity was authentically and vividly brought to life.

Following the culinary showcase was a traditional performance segment where international students sang and danced to folk-inspired melodies. The vibrant rhythms and roaring applause blended into a rich cultural mosaic—alive with the spirit of exchange and unity.
